Iran’s “There Are Things” competes at Karlovy Vary

TEHRAN, June 16 (MNA) -- Iran’s “There Are Things You Don’t Know” by Fardin Sahebozzamani is entered in the main competition section of 45th Karlovy Vary International Film Festival in the Czech Republic.

This is the first feature film entry by the young director at the festival running from July 2 to 10.

Ali is a taxi driver who tries to avoid any kind of adventure. Sima, an old school friend, nevertheless tries to revive their old friendship, helping to relieve his isolation.

Starring Ali Mosaffa, Leila Hatami, and Mahtab Karamati, the movie has not yet been screened in Iran.

Abdorreza Kahani’s “Twenty” won the jury special award at the 44th edition of the gala last year.
